Diet and Foraging
Introduction
The diet of Hooded Tinamou is very poorly known. Reported to eat seeds of bamboo (Fjeldså and Krabbe 1990). Also reported to eat fallen fruit (T.A. Parker, unpublished observations), as does the closely related Highland Tinamou (Nothocercus bonapartei). Probably also consumes invertebrates.
